What is an RF controller?

What is an RF controller? (Radio Frequency remote control) A handheld, wireless device used to operate audio, video and other electronic equipment using radio frequency (RF) transmission. Unlike the common infrared (IR) remotes, RF remotes do not have to be aimed at the equipment. How do you make a RF remote? Can a speaker be plugged into a running computer?

Can a speaker be plugged into a running computer? Can I plug speakers into a running computer? Yes. It is ok to plug in and disconnect speakers while the computer is on and running. Most operating systems today also show a pop-up notice when speakers are plugged into and disconnected from the computer. Test the speakers What kind of mini jack do I need for speakers? Where are the timing marks on a Ford Explorer?

Where are the timing marks on a Ford Explorer? Look at the front of the engine facing from the grill. Locate the timing case cover directly in the center of the engine's face. It should appear as an off-center elliptical smooth metal piece. The timing marker is on the upper left side of the cover. It is an arrow-shaped piece of metal. How to check the automatic transmission fluid in a 2002 Ford?

How to check the automatic transmission fluid in a 2002 Ford? Remove the dipstick and place a funnel into the dipstick tube. Add Mercon V automatic transmission fluid -- available at Ford dealers -- in small increments. Check the fluid level with the dipstick between each increment to ensure you do not overfill the transmission. What's the best way to check your transmission fluid? Insert long funnel into automatic transmission fluid dipstick hole. Carefully add automatic transmission fluid in small increments and recheck level each time until fluid level reaches "warm" line.
